Mrs. Eileen Wiggins Lindsey, age 82, of Riddleville, died Sunday, August 6, 2017 at Tennille Retirement Home. A funeral service will be held on Wednesday, August 9 th at 11:00 a.m. at Jackson’s Baptist Church with burial in the church cemetery. Reverend Danny Thomas, Reverend Fred Morrison and Reverend Mike Jones will officiate. Pallbearers will be Jamie Lindsey, Charlie Lindsey, Chad Foskey, Chris Bryan, Jason Bryan and Jacob Burkhalter.
Mrs. Lindsey was a native and lifelong resident of Washington County, the daughter of the late Charlie G. Wiggins Sr. and the late Ethel Sheppard Wiggins. She was a home maker and also formerly employed by Royal Manufacturing and the William Carter Company where she worked as a supervisor and assistant manager. In retirement, Mrs. Lindsey worked as a greeter for Walmart. She attended the Jackson’s Baptist Church and she is predeceased by her husband, James Edward Lindsey and brothers, C.G. Wiggins Jr. and William L. Wiggins.
Survivors are: her son, Don and his wife Gloria Lindsey; daughter , Debra L. Bryan and David Lindsey all of Riddleville; grandchildren, Chris Bryan and his wife Callie of Milledgeville, Jason Bryan and his wife Kelly of Tennille, Jamie Lindsey and his wife Crissy, Charlie Lindsey and his wife Regina all of Riddleville and Pamela Foskey and her husband Chad of Gray; ten great grandchildren; two great great grandchildren; sister, Annie Mary Freeman of Toomsboro; and sisters-in-law’s, Jackie Lindsey of Augusta, Annette Lindsey of Swainsboro and Barbara Wiggins of Sandersville.
The family will be at the residence of Don and Gloria Lindsey on Old Savannah Road and they will receive friends on Tuesday from 5:00 p.m. until 7:00 p.m. at May and Smith Funeral Home in Sandersville.
Donations may be made to Jackson’s Baptist Church Cemetery Fund c/o Debra Bryan 10502 Old Savannah Rd., Sandersville, Ga. 31082 or to Tennille Retirement Home Patient Activity Fund, 525 N. Main Street, Tennille, Ga. 31089.
May and Smith Funeral Directors is in charge of these arrangements.
